Output 64f0f65e271ac52c76ea58cdac9ee256cbfdad8f35ebf96fbe61d091f0a6c667:0

value
4520674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c52aa26f79393713d0a2134dc1033290fca441 OP_EQUAL
address
3QBpM755QHCJbza48gZwCCBxe4y7o3uUcE
transaction
64f0f65e271ac52c76ea58cdac9ee256cbfdad8f35ebf96fbe61d091f0a6c667
confirmations
303101
spent
true